Bogotá, CO · active
Nefarious Exterminium is a Death Metal band from Bogotá, Colombia, formed in 2024. The band released their debut full-length "After the Perverse Act" in April 2025 through Ácido Music Studio, an eight-track record built around themes of violence, perversion, and chaos.
Formosa, AR · 2010–present · active
Nefastus is a death metal band from Formosa, Argentina whose self-titled debut EP, released in 2023, drew notice from Metal Forces Magazine for balancing brutality with melody across five tracks. Drummer Ives Lescano's work was specifically highlighted in that review, with tracks spanning from thrashy direct assault to more technical mid-tempo arrangements.
Rio de Janeiro, BR · 2016–present · on-hold
Born from members of Disfigured By Hatred, Nefärioüs D-saster channel the raw fury of Anti Cimex and D-beat punk through a death metal filter on releases like the 2018 Worship Disaster EP and the 2018 split Total Disaster. Their sound is a deliberately abrasive collision of nuclear-age dread, war imagery, and underground punk nihilism.
São Paulo, BR · 2018–present · active
Negative Delusion deal in straightforward old-school death metal rooted firmly in the 1990s tradition, as heard on their 2018 debut album Claustrophobic. The nine-track record leans into claustrophobic riff structures and mid-paced brutality, placing them squarely in the lineage of early Florida and Swedish death metal.
Brasília, BR · 2019–present · active
Nekkrofuneral deals in old-school black/death savagery rooted in the Brazilian underground tradition, with Z. Misanthrope on bass and vocals, M. Marra on guitars, and C. Couto on drums. Their 2021 split "A Epítome da Decadência Humana" with Numbomb showcases the band's raw, crust-tinged attack recorded and mixed at Heavy Track Estúdio.
Petrolina, BR · 2023–present · active
Nekrommander is a one-person black/death metal project helmed by Ghul, whose 2023 EP "Vomiting in Heaven" was years in the making — drums tracked in 2019, the rest completed through 2023. The five-track release blends crunchy old-school death metal with thrash sharpness and hardcore-inflected groove, with session drums contributed by Douglas Batista.
Betim, BR · 2023–present · active
Nekropsalms is a death metal act from Betim signed to Headbanger's Behavior, dealing in themes of anti-Christianity, occultism, and apocalyptic violence. The band emerged in 2023 and operates squarely within the old-school Brazilian death metal tradition.
Porto Alegre, BR · 2025–present · split-up
Originally operating under the name Interior Soul before adopting the Nephasth moniker in 1999, this death metal unit built an early reputation through tape-trading alongside peers like Krisiun and Rebaelliun, and landed on Relapse Records' influential Brazilian Assault compilation. Their 2001 Mercenary Musik debut Immortal Unholy Triumph established their relentless approach, followed by the technically sharpened Conceived by Inhuman Blood in 2004 before the band dissolved in 2005.
São Paulo, BR · 1996–present · active
One of São Paulo's most enduring extreme metal acts, Nervochaos have been churning out abrasive, chaotic death metal since 1996, with a catalog spanning ten studio albums and drawing influence from Morbid Angel, Vader, and Sinister. Their 2022 album All Colors of Darkness, released via Emanzipation Productions, is their tenth full-length and keeps the formula intact: satanic lyrical themes, brutal atmosphere, and a technical backbone refined over nearly three decades.
